The Liverpool captain scored on the penalty spot in stoppage time.

Heart-stopping suspense is a familiar feeling that Liverpool has brought to fans of this team recently.

Playing at home, being rated much higher than their opponents, Liverpool could not score during the first 80 minutes.

Amid overwhelming disappointment, Liverpool fans seemed to be pulled back from hell when the home team was awarded a penalty.

Liverpool 2-1 Ludogorets

Liverpool is temporarily ranked second in Group B, behind Real Madrid.

Compared to the shocking 0-1 loss to Aston Villa last weekend, Liverpool played more smoothly against Ludogorets.

However, the Red Brigade has not yet shown the speed and ability to attack like they did last season.

Ludogorets were guests but played with confidence.

Balotelli showed his killer instinct despite not playing outstandingly throughout the match.

Lacking sharpness in finishing situations, a red shirt player finally spoke up at the right time.

Liverpool almost lost victory due to an individual mistake.

Just one minute later, the away team’s goalkeeper carelessly fouled defender Manquillo in the penalty area, giving Liverpool a penalty and the winning goal for The Kop.
